Market Size and Trends

The Title Insurance market is estimated to be valued at USD 19.3 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 29.7 billion by 2032,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.2% from 2025 to 2032. This steady growth reflects increasing real estate transactions and heightened awareness of the importance of protecting property rights, which are key drivers influencing market expansion during this period.

Current market trends indicate a rising adoption of digital platforms and automation technologies to streamline title search and insurance processes, improving efficiency and customer experience. Additionally, growing regulatory requirements and the expanding residential and commercial real estate sectors are propelling demand for title insurance services globally. Innovations such as blockchain integration are also gaining traction, enhancing transparency and security in title transactions, which further supports sustained market growth.

By Policy Type: Predominance of Owner's Policy Driven by Enhanced Protection and Market Demand

In terms of By Policy Type, Owner's Policy contributes the highest share of the market owing to its comprehensive coverage that protects property buyers against potential defects or claims on the title after purchase. This segment has gained significant traction as homeowners increasingly seek security and peace of mind in real estate transactions. The Owner's Policy serves as a critical safeguard, covering risks such as unknown liens, encroachments, or fraudulent documents that could jeopardize property ownership. Rising awareness about the importance of protecting property rights has encouraged more buyers to opt for Owner's Policies over other types, even when lender requirements do not mandate it. Additionally, regulatory frameworks in many regions underscore the necessity for thorough title protection, further driving the adoption of Owner's Policies. The flexibility in coverage and the added assurance for asset accumulation make this policy the first choice for individual consumers who want to avoid lengthy legal disputes and financial losses related to title issues. As homeownership remains a key component of wealth-building strategies, the demand for Owner's Policy is bolstered by demographic trends such as increasing urbanization, first-time buyers entering the market, and greater emphasis on secure property investments. The segment's growth is also supported by technological advancements in title searching and risk assessment, which streamline the issuance of Owner's Policies, enhancing customer experience and expediting transactions. Collectively, these factors solidify the Owner's Policy as the primary driver within the title insurance market by policy type.

By End User: Residential Segment Leads Due to Rising Housing Demand and Enhanced Property Security Needs

In terms of By End User, Residential contributes the highest share of the market as a consequence of sustained demand in the housing sector coupled with an increased focus on protecting residential real estate investments. The residential segment's dominance is largely attributed to the volume of property transactions within this category, including single-family homes, condominiums, and townhouses. Economic factors such as population growth, urban expansion, and evolving housing preferences continue to fuel robust residential real estate activities globally. Homebuyers prioritize title insurance to mitigate risks associated with ownership disputes, undisclosed easements, or unresolved inheritance claims that could affect their peaceful possession of the property. Moreover, lenders frequently require title insurance for residential property loans, reinforcing the segment's strong market position. The residential market's complexity, including second homes, vacation properties, and rental units, further necessitates comprehensive title protection. Innovations in streamlined underwriting and risk evaluation have made title insurance more accessible and affordable for individual buyers, intensifying its uptake in this segment. Additionally, heightened regulatory oversight and consumer protection laws ensure that residential buyers are better informed about potential title risks, indirectly boosting demand for insurance. The segment also benefits from the increasing role of technology in home buying, such as online property listings and digital closings, which integrate seamlessly with title insurance services to create efficient transaction ecosystems. These dynamics firmly establish the residential segment as the leading end-user category in title insurance.

Regional Insights:

Dominating Region: North America

In North America, the dominance in the Title Insurance market can be largely attributed to a mature real estate ecosystem supported by well-established legal frameworks that mandate title insurance for property transactions. The U.S. in particular benefits from a robust regulatory environment that helps stabilize the market by reducing risks associated with property ownership and transfer. Government policies, including standardized property registration systems and consumer protection laws, further enhance market confidence. The presence of major industry players such as Fidelity National Financial, First American Financial Corporation, and Stewart Information Services driving innovation and competitive offerings has consolidated this region's leadership. Additionally, the significant volume of real estate transactions supported by a diverse economy ensures sustained demand for title insurance products. Trade dynamics, including foreign investments in real estate, also add to the market's complexity and breadth.

Fastest-Growing Region: Asia Pacific

Meanwhile, the Asia Pacific exhibits the fastest growth in the Title Insurance market, fueled by rapid urbanization, increasing foreign direct investments, and expanding real estate markets in emerging economies such as China, India, and Southeast Asian countries. The evolving property laws and government initiatives aimed at formalizing land ownership and reducing fraud have been pivotal in fostering market growth. Many countries in this region are witnessing improvements in land administration infrastructure, such as digital land registries that enhance transparency and efficiency. The industrial landscape is becoming increasingly competitive with new entrants and partnerships between local and international title insurance providers like Knight Frank, ICICI Lombard, and Nihon Unisys entering the market. Moreover, the surge in commercial real estate developments and growing middle-class populations aspiring for homeownership are driving demand for title insurance products.

Title Insurance Market Outlook for Key Countries

United States

The U.S. market remains the cornerstone of the global title insurance industry due to its comprehensive legal framework ensuring property transaction integrity. Prominent firms such as Fidelity National Financial and First American Financial Corporation dominate, leveraging extensive agent networks and technology-driven underwriting processes. The government's strong emphasis on consumer protection and mandatory title insurance in real estate closings sustains steady market activity. The dynamic growth of both residential and commercial real estate, alongside rising real estate valuations, continue to encourage innovation in coverage and services.

China

China's title insurance market is rapidly expanding as the government institutes reforms to improve property rights registration and reduce encumbrances in the real estate sector. Local companies, supported by joint ventures with international insurers, are driving product adaptation suited to the regulatory environment. The rise of secondary cities and increased infrastructure investments propel title insurance demand. Companies such as PICC Property and Casualty Company and ZhongAn Online are notable contributors, working to integrate technology and enhanced risk management systems to serve an increasingly complex market.

India

India's growing real estate sector, coupled with government efforts to digitize land records and introduce transparent title verification processes, underpins the expanding title insurance market. Firms such as ICICI Lombard and Bajaj Allianz are active players providing tailored title insurance products for both residential and commercial properties. Regulatory developments, including the Real Estate (Regulation and Development) Act (RERA), have improved market confidence. The influx of foreign investments and increased urban housing developments are expected to create more opportunities for title insurers.

Australia

Australia continues to lead in market maturity within the Asia Pacific title insurance landscape. Well-established legal standards and high property transaction volumes support demand. The presence of key firms like QBE Insurance Group and FirstTitle Insurance ensures competitive product offerings and innovation in risk assessment. The government's efforts towards digitizing property and land registry systems have reduced friction in real estate transactions, further bolstering title insurance adoption. The market is also shaped by strong residential housing markets in Sydney and Melbourne, enhancing business prospects for insurers.

United Kingdom

The United Kingdom's title insurance market benefits from its well-developed real estate sector characterized by complex property laws and a high volume of both residential and commercial transactions. Companies such as Stewart Title and Lawyers Title provide comprehensive coverage solutions tailored to UK regulations. The government's focus on transparency in property dealings and reforms in land registry procedures contribute positively. Moreover, increasing cross-border real estate investments in cities like London have heightened the relevance of title insurance to mitigate ownership risks and legal disputes.
